Title of article :
Analysis of auxiliary crowning in parallel gear shaving

Abstract :
Gear shaving is one of the most efficient and economical ways to finish gears roughed by gear hobbing or shaping. In parallel gear shaving process, the tooth profile of workgear can be longitudinally crowned by an auxiliary crowning mechanism that rocks the workgear with respect to a moving pivot. There are two independent motion parameters in parallel shaving, the tight rotational meshing between workgear and shaving cutter and the traverse motion of the workgear by moving pivot. A mathematical model for the tooth profile of workgear finished by the parallel shaving process is proposed to simulate the kinematical motion of parallel shaving process with the auxiliary crowning mechanism by two parameter meshing equations. The proposed mathematical model is verified by experiment and can be applied to calculate the crowning of the workgear from the machine setup of crowning mechanism.
